Overview
Blonde Poison is based on the true story of Stella Goldschlag, and takes the form of an interview in 1991 between Stella and a well-respected journalist. A Jewish woman caught in hiding and tortured during World War II, she agreed to become a ‘Greifer’ for the Gestapo and betrayed up to 3,000 fellow Jews The vast dimensions of Stella’s character range from tortured victim to cruel killer, from loving daughter to betrayer of friends, from gentle lover to depraved promiscuity.
